We can’t wait to see our Team Make Some Noise runners back on the iconic Great North Run city to sea course in September; starting in Newcastle City Centre, and heading towards the River Tyne, and finishing at the traditional finish line in South Shields.
This unique 13.1-mile route takes runners over the iconic Tyne Bridge and along the sea front in South Shields, and you may even catch a glimpse of the Red Arrows flying overhead!
